]> git.ipfire.org Git - thirdparty/openembedded/openembedded-core.git/commit
classes-global/insane: Look up all runtime providers for file-rdeps
authorJoshua Watt <JPEWhacker@gmail.com>
Tue, 11 Feb 2025 13:49:18 +0000 (13:49 +0000)
committerSteve Sakoman <steve@sakoman.com>
Wed, 12 Feb 2025 16:18:49 +0000 (08:18 -0800)
commit0ff31972b60dda5d8bada2ffb428cc54bb49e8cf
tree1799c0b90cde1cc499a9b1a0a1d24d9a833c84c9
parent579717212ba2892e32315788ccd65320556d32a3
classes-global/insane: Look up all runtime providers for file-rdeps

Uses the new foreach_runtime_provider_pkgdata() API to look up all
possible runtime providers of a given dependency when resolving
file-rdeps. This allows the check to correctly handle RPROVIDES for
non-virtual dependencies

(From OE-Core rev: 018fa1b7cb5e6a362ebb45b93e52b0909a782ac9)

Signed-off-by: Joshua Watt <JPEWhacker@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Signed-off-by: Steve Sakoman <steve@sakoman.com>
meta/classes/insane.bbclass